Services Provided by Property Management Companies

Property management companies offer a variety of services intended to streamline the rental process for every party. Key services include:

• Promoting rental listings efficiently – They list rental properties on well-known online portals and local property sites, they help attract serious applicants. Experts leverage local insight about regions like Blakely AL and Grand Bay AL to reach the ideal market.

• Renter vetting and lease administration – Managers thoroughly vet prospective tenants to confirm they satisfy all criteria. Additionally, they handle the creation, execution, and renewal of leases to ensure clarity and fairness.

• Rent collection and financial reporting – Specialists implement processes that ensure timely rent collection and meticulous financial reporting. This method allows owners to easily monitor payments and control costs.

• Property upkeep and urgent repair services – Whether facing immediate repair issues in Mobile or standard maintenance requirements in locations like Gaillard Island AL, managers are equipped to act swiftly to ensure safety and comfort.

Questions to Ask Before Hiring a Property Manager

Before making a decision, inquire of prospective property managers using several key questions:

• What service fees should I expect, and what do they include?

• How are tenants screened and assigned?

• What is your process for handling maintenance requests and emergency repairs?

• Do you offer references or case studies from other local landlords?

The responses to these inquiries will provide insight into the company’s professionalism and experience. Following this strategy ensures you hire a property manager who meets your needs in Mobile, AL and surrounding communities like Prichard AL, Malibar Heights AL, and Blakely AL.
